You can use a template or create a promissory note online. But before you begin, you'll need to gather some information and make decisions about the way the loan will be structured. First, you'll need the names and addresses of both the lender (or "payee") and the borrower.
Even if you have the original note, it may be void if it was not written correctly. If the person you're trying to collect from didn't sign it and yes, this happens the note is void. It may also become void if it failed some other law, for example, if it was charging an illegally high rate of interest.

A bank can issue a promissory note, but so can an individual or a company or business. Anyone who lends money can do so. A promissory note isn't a contract, but you'll likely have to sign one before you take out a mortgage.
In order for a promissory note to be valid and legally binding, it needs to include specific information. "A promissory note should include details including the amount loaned, the repayment schedule and whether it is secured or unsecured," says Wheeler.
Characteristics of promissory note:It is a written legal document. There must be a clear, point to point and unconditional promise of paying a certain amount to a specified person. It should be drawn and signed by the maker. It should be stamped properly. It specifically identifies the name of the maker and payee.
